Chanukkah is the Feast of Dedication (John 10:22) which commemorates the rededication of the Temple after it had been redeemed from the hands of the pagan Antiochus, the Seleudid king.  Another eight day occasion sees lighting of one additional candle each night.  Our course will recall the history of Chanukkah as well as its special songs and cuisine.  Yeshua is recognized as the Light of the World particularly on Chanukkah.

Purim calls to mind the Book of Esther and the Persian attempt to engage in genocide against the Jewish people.  The history rehearses divine intervention and the rescue of Israel.  The methods associated with the custom of reading the entire scroll of Esther and other fascinating Purim practices will delight every learner.
